Paella and salad was provided by Paella Depot, a local food truck service, and additional desserts and drinks were prepared and served by department student workers. <a href=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/the-words-october-2021\/fall-luncheon-2021\/\">Read more about the luncheon&#8230;<\/a><\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large is-resized\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"768\" src=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Fall-Luncheon-1-1024x768.jpg\" alt=\"Students and faculty sitting together on blankets on a grassy campus lawn, eating lunch and talking under trees on a sunny day.\" class=\"wp-image-3731\" style=\"width:320px;height:auto\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Fall-Luncheon-1-1024x768.jpg 1024w,  https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Fall-Luncheon-1-300x225.jpg 300w,  https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Fall-Luncheon-1-768x576.jpg 768w,  https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Fall-Luncheon-1-1536x1152.jpg 1536w,  https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Fall-Luncheon-1-2048x1536.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\" \/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">An Evening with Stephanie Burt and Rachel Gold<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Patrick Coy-Bjork &#8217;23<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ignleft\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"150\" height=\"150\" src=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/B1F3ECD8-CB06-4D4B-B7D8-5502E74CC7C1_4_5005_c-150x150.jpeg\" alt=\"Stephanie Burt and Rachel Gold\" class=\"wp-image-3752\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">This past Thursday, I got to attend the wonderful presentation given by Stephanie Burt at the Dewitt Wallace Library. Dr. Burt, who is currently teaching at Harvard, was a professor at Macalester between 2000-2007. Since then, she has written and published several poetry collections as well as a book on reading poetry (cheekily titled <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Don\u2019t Read Poetry). After being introduced by current English professor Rachel Gold, Stephanie read poems from her collections Advice from the Lights, After Callimachus, and For All Mutants<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">. My biggest takeaway from the sharing of these works was the incredible passion Burt has for whatever she is writing about. Whether it\u2019s trans and queer identity, neurodiversity, social justice, or cartoons, she writes with both delicate care and intense purpose, making it clear that the focuses of her work have strong personal significance to her. <a href=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/the-words-october-2021\/an-evening-with-stephanie-burt-and-rachel-gold\/\">Read more about the evening&#8230;<\/a><\/span><em><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"><br><\/span><\/em><\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\" \/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Chatting with Kerry Alexander of Bad Bad Hats<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Alice Asch &#8217;22<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ignright\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"300\" height=\"243\" src=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Kerry-Alexander-e1633559814587-300x243.jpg\" alt=\"A musician performs on stage under red lighting, wearing a knit hat and playing an electric guitar.\" class=\"wp-image-3758\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Kerry-Alexander-e1633559814587-300x243.jpg 300w,  https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/10\/Kerry-Alexander-e1633559814587.jpg 519w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Kerry Alexander, esteemed co-founder of the band Bad Bad Hats, also happens to be an alumna of Macalester\u2019s English Department. <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">The Words<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> recently caught up with Kerry over email to discuss (among other things) open mics at Dunn Bros, the T.V show <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Chopped<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">, and \u201cfinding the Elton John to my Bernie Taupin.\u201d <a href=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/the-words-october-2021\/chatting-with-kerry-alexander-of-bad-bad-hats\/\">Click here to learn more about Kerry&#8230;<\/a><\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\" \/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">English Honor Society: Semester Ahead &amp; Introducing New Officers<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>Kira Schukar &#8217;22<\/b><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ignleft\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"150\" height=\"150\" src=\"https:\/\/www.macalester.edu\/the-words\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/603\/2021\/09\/Portrait-1-150x150.jpeg\" alt=\"A person in a red jacket stands outdoors near a wooden structure with picnic tables and greenery in the background.\" class=\"wp-image-3645\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">This year, English Honor Society (EHS) is back with community events, book talks, and volunteer opportunities!
